How they compare
Niger currently reports 2.53 million against 2.41 million in Ukraine, a difference of 123,670.
That makes Niger's figure about 1.1 times Ukraine's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 26 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Ukraine ahead.
Niger ranks 54th and Ukraine ranks 55th of 191 countries.
Ukraine has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Niger | Ukraine |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 1.20 million | 4.46 million | 3.26 million | Ukraine |
| 2000s | 1.68 million | 4.05 million | 2.37 million | Ukraine |
| 2010s | 2.30 million | 2.69 million | 389,072 | Ukraine |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
